Family Devotion 2022-05-1 Pilgrimage to Zion Psalm 48:1-14 ESV (Together Read-aloud) Many Jews pilgrimage to Jerusalem to celebrate when they heard about Hezekiah's great victory over Sennacherib (2 Kings 18-19). Christians today are citizens of the heavenly Zion and are also making a pilgrimage (Heb. 12:18-24). As pilgrims, we talk about Zion (verses 1-3). We talk about the God who has made Zion great and His protection. We talk about Zion's beauty. Spiritually, Zion is the joy of the whole earth (Gen. 12:1-3). As pilgrims, we see Zion (verses 4-8). We look to Jerusalem and are encouraged in our faith. Hezekiah had no way to fight the Assyrians, but he had the Lord. He spread a blasphemous letter from the Assyrians before the Lord and turned everything over to Him. God acted. The Assyrian army was outside, waiting to plunder the city, but they were gone as suddenly as a woman who was taken by childbirth (verses 5-6). When we're in the will of God, we have His protection. As pilgrims, we enter Zion (verses 9-11). The Jews went to the temple first. It's good to ponder history. I trust that when you are at church, you think about God's lovingkindness and about taking His praise to the ends of the earth (v.10). we have a greater victory to share with the earth: our Lord Jesus died for us and has risen again. As pilgrims, we walk about Zion (verses 12-14). This is a triumphant procession of praise. When Nehemiah rededicated the wall, two choirs walked around the wall and met (Neh. 12:27-47). Appreciate what you have and what God has done for you, that you may tell the following generation. Unfortunately, the people of Israel did not stay faithful (Lamentations 2:14 – 5). Let's be careful that we don't take our blessings for granted. –– Warren Wiersbe's – A Daily Walk Through the Psalms, 2011, pg 129. Reflection: You are making a pilgrimage to the heavenly Zion. Be encouraged, for you are God’s protection. That you are on a pilgrimage should e evident in your daily living. Praise Him for what He has done for you. Christian Book Discussion Club 阅读小组 Christian book discussion club is a group of people who meet to discuss a book and grow together in truth and in knowledge in a practical way. Marriage: 6 Gospel Commitments Every Couple Needs to Make When you say “I do,” you begin the journey of a lifetime― and you have dreams of that journey being perfect. But it won’t take long for expectations of the perfect marriage to fade away in the struggles of everyday life. A long-term, vibrant marriage needs to be grounded in something sturdier than romance―it needs the life-changing power of the gospel. In this rebranded edition of What Did You Expect? Popular author and pastor Paul David Tripp encourages couples to make six biblical commitments to the Lord and to one another. These commitments, which include a lifestyle of confession and forgiveness, building trust, and appreciating differences, will equip couples to cultivate thriving, joy- filled marriages built on Christ.
